function Get-PspSecurityUpdate { <# .SYNOPSIS Get all the security update information for local or remote machines. .DESCRIPTION Get all the security update information for local or remote machines. Tries to create a CIM session to obtain information, but will revert to DCOM if CIM is not available. If there's already a CIM session available, this can also be used to obtain the data. .PARAMETER ComputerName Provide the computername(s) to query. This will create a new CIM session which will be removed once the information has been gathered. Default value is the local machine. .PARAMETER Credential Provide the credentials for the CIM session to be created if current credentials are not sufficient. .PARAMETER CimSession Provide the CIM session object to query if this is already available. Once the information has been gathered, the CIM session will remain available for further use. .EXAMPLE PS C:\> Get-PspSecurityUpdate -ComputerName CONTOSO-SRV01,CONTOSO-SRV02 ComputerName Type KBFile InstallDate ------------ ---- ------ ----------- CONTOSO-SRV01 Update KB4049065 2/2/2018 12:00:00 AM CONTOSO-SRV01 Security Update KB4048953 2/2/2018 12:00:00 AM CONTOSO-SRV02 Update KB4464455 10/29/2018 12:00:00 AM Gets the installed security updates for CONTOSO-SRV01 and CONTOSO-SRV02, displaying the default properties. .NOTES Name: Get-PspSecurityUpdate.ps1 Author: Robert Prüst Module: PSP-Inventory DateCreated: 21-02-2019 DateModified: 12-03-2019 Blog: https://powershellpr0mpt.com .LINK https://powershellpr0mpt.com #> [OutputType('PSP.Inventory.SecurityUpdate')] [Cmdletbinding(DefaultParameterSetName = 'Computer')] param( [Parameter(Position = 0, ValueFromPipeline = $true, ValueFromPipelineByPropertyName = $true, ParameterSetName = 'Computer')] [ValidateNotNullorEmpty()] [Alias('CN')] [String[]]$ComputerName = $env:COMPUTERNAME, [Parameter(ParameterSetName = 'Computer')] [PSCredential]$Credential, [Parameter(Position = 0, ValueFromPipeline = $true, ParameterSetName = 'Session')] [Alias('Session')] [Microsoft.Management.Infrastructure.CimSession[]]$CimSession ) process { if ($PSCmdlet.ParameterSetName -eq 'Computer') { $CimSession = @() $CimProperties = @{ ErrorAction = 'Stop' Computername = '' } if ($credential.Username) { $CimProperties.Add('Credential', $Credential) } foreach ($Computer in $ComputerName) { $Computer = $Computer.toUpper() ` $CimProperties.ComputerName = $Computer Try { $CimSession += New-CimSession @CimProperties } catch [Microsoft.Management.Infrastructure.CimException] { Write-Warning "[$Computer] - does not have CIM access, reverting to DCOM instead" $CimOptions = New-CimSessionOption -Protocol DCOM $CimProperties.Add('SessionOption', $CimOptions) | Out-Null try { $CimSession += New-CimSession @CimProperties } catch { Write-Warning "[$Computer] - cannot be reached. $($_.Exception.Message)" } Finally { $CimProperties.Remove('SessionOption') | Out-Null } } Catch { Write-Warning "[$Computer] - cannot be reached. $($_.Exception.Message)" } } } foreach ($Session in $CimSession) { _GetUpdateInfo -Cimsession $Session } } End { if ($PSCmdlet.ParameterSetName -eq 'Computer' -AND $CimSession.count -gt 0) { Remove-Cimsession $CimSession } } } |
